Data Scientist Manager- Azure Monitor

Microsoft

Join us to build the next generation of capabilities for Artificial Intelligence for IT Operations (AIOps), developing machine learning algorithms to scan vast data sources, identify service faults and generate insights for Azure users to gain powerful ways to improve service quality and reliability. We are building a new way to investigate service issues by creating advanced anomaly detection, across a wide set of Azure resources and application workloads and using LLM for creating AI-generated Insight providing an actionable summary of what happened, possible causes, and a set of next steps helping users resolve the issue.
